The FiOS' Motorola DVR does not support drive expansion and you cannot upgrade the hard drive. The firmware is "hard coded" to use a maximum of 160GB. Verizon does plan to offer a higher capacity (i.e. 320GB) DVR next year.
The TivoHD and Moxi both support FiOS using one Verizon CableCard (M-CARD). Both support external drive expansion. The TivoHD is available in 160GB and 1TB models, and both models allow internal drive upgrades. It costs $80-$90 to upgrade the 160TB model to 1TB.

Once you open the tivo isnt the warranty voided ? Yes, it will. If you don't want to void the warranty, then you can always buy a My DVR Expander. I prefer the internal drive approach, however.
Also where do you find a 1tb drive to put in there and how difficult is it to do ? You can see a list of recommended drives here (http://www.avsforum.com/avs-vb/showthread.php?p=11126048#drives). Instructions are here (http://www.avsforum.com/avs-vb/showthread.php?p=11126048#upgrade).
It's not difficult. The drive is easy to remove. You connect the original drive to your computer and click "backup" in a free program. Then you connect the new drive and click "restore." That's it.
So with tivo i would ask fios for 1 m-card ?Yes, although you only need to ask for a CableCard. FiOS only carries M-CARDs now. They just list "CableCards" in their system.
